PPT单击此处输入你的正文,文字是您思想的提炼,为了最终演示发布的良好效果,请尽量言简意赅的阐述观点;根据需要可酌情增减文字。汇报人:PPTTABFWEB前端开发规范方案文档
-引言概述代码编写规范项目结构规范技术选型规范文档与沟通规范维护与优化规范培训与团队建设版本控制与迭代目录文档与知识管理持续改进与优化总结
汇报人:PPTTABFPART-1引言
引言本篇演讲稿将详细阐述一套完整的WEB前端开发规范方案文档,旨在提高开发效率、保证代码质量、优化用户体验以及便于后期维护在当今互联网高速发展的时代,WEB前端开发作为网站或应用的重要组成部分,其开发规范的制定与执行显得尤为重要
汇报人:PPTTABFPART-2概述
概述6本规范方案文档旨在为WEB前端开发人员提供一套统一的开发标准,包括但不限于代码编写规范、项目结构、技术选型、测试与部署等方面通过遵循本规范,我们期望能够提高团队的开发效率,降低出错率,同时保证项目的可维护性和可扩展性
汇报人:PPTTABFPART-3代码编写规范
代码编写规范2.1语法规范遵循ES6+的语法规范:鼓励使用现代JavaScript特性代码缩进统一使用2个空格:不使用制表符注释清晰明了:描述代码功能、目的及注意事项
代码编写规范变量、函数、类等命名使用小驼峰式命名法避免使用过于复杂或模糊的命名保持命名简洁且具有描述性常量使用全大写字母命名单词间使用下划线分隔2.2命名规范
代码编写规范2.3模块化与复用鼓励使用ES6模块化语法进行代码组织提取公共代码至公用模块:避免重复编写遵循单一职责原则:每个模块负责一个特定的功能
汇报人:PPTTABFPART-4项目结构规范
项目结构规范3.1文件组织按照功能或模块划分文件夹:如公共模块、业务模块等文件命名遵循语义化命名规则:方便后期维护与理解
项目结构规范3.2构建工具与自动化流程使用Webpack或Rollup等构建工具进行项目构建与打包利用Git进行版本控制:并设置合理的分支策略自动化测试与部署:减少人工操作,提高效率
汇报人:PPTTABFPART-5技术选型规范
技术选型规范4.1前端框架与库选择根据项目需求选择合适的框架(如React、Vue、Angular等)选择常用的UI库(如Bootstrap、AntDesign等)以加快开发速度12
技术选型规范4.2性能优化技术使用懒加载、按需加载等技术优化页面加载速度利用CSS3动画等替代JavaScript动画以提升性能对图片等资源进行压缩优化:减少资源消耗
汇报人:PPTTABFPART-6测试与部署规范
测试与部署规范5.1单元测试与集成测试对关键代码进行单元测试:确保功能正确性进行集成测试以验证模块间协作的稳定性
测试与部署规范5.2部署流程与监控建立自动化的部署流程:如CI/CD流程对项目进行实时监控:及时发现并处理问题建立问题反馈机制:及时收集用户反馈并进行修复
汇报人:PPTTABFPART-7响应式与适配规范
响应式与适配规范采用流式布局或响应式框架确保网站或应用在不同设备和屏幕尺寸下都能良好地展示6.1响应式设计利用媒体查询来定义不同屏幕尺寸下的样式规则
响应式与适配规范6.2跨浏览器兼容性对常用浏览器进行兼容性测试:如Chrome、Firefo、Safari、Edge以及IE等利用工具如BrowserStack进行跨浏览器测试:确保在各种浏览器中的表现一致
汇报人:PPTTABFPART-8可访问性与无障碍性规范
可访问性与无障碍性规范7.1可访问性设计提供清晰的导航和标识:帮助用户轻松理解网站或应用的结构使用语义化的HTML标签:提高页面的可读性和可访问性
可访问性与无障碍性规范7.2无障碍性优化提供语音搜索和朗读功能:满足视障用户的需求确保所有交互元素都能通过键盘进行操作:方便残障人士使用
汇报人:PPTTABFPART-9UI/U设计规范
UI/U设计规范8.1设计原则与风格统一遵循用户体验设计原则:如简洁、直观、一致性等统一设计风格:保持品牌的一致性
UI/U设计规范8.2组件与交互规范定义常用组件的交互逻辑和样式规范:如按钮、输入框、下拉框等确保不同页面间的交互逻辑一致:提高用户体验
汇报人:PPTTABFPART-10文档与沟通规范
文档与沟通规范9.1技术文档编写为每个模块、功能编写详细的文档:包括功能描述、使用方法、注意事项等使用版本控制工具对文档进行管理:确保团队成员查看的是最新文档
文档与沟通规范9.2沟通与协作规范建立有效的沟通渠道:如团队群聊、周会等,以便团队成员及时交流和协作使用任务管理工具对项目进行跟踪和管理:确保任务按时完成
汇报人:PPTTABFPART-11安全与隐私保护规范
安全与隐私保护规范